UAE leads Gulf in 5G download speed: report

UAE has the fastest average 5G download speed among countries in the Arabian Gulf, with smartphone users having experienced speeds of 316.8 Mbps according to a report by UK-based company, Opensignal.

Extending its lead for fifth generation (5G) peak download speed as well, UAE was ahead of Qatar with a score of 743 Mbps, 713.4 Mbps in Qatar and 663.7 Mbps in Kuwait.

The GCC 5G Experience Benchmark studied smartphone users’ 5G experience when using the 5G network for mobile video streaming, multiplayer mobile gaming, and voice app communication. Additionally, it looked into 5G availability and speed, as well as the uplift in experience compared with older 4G services.

“5G is continuing to advance across the GCC. In all six markets, users experience much improved speeds and video experience using 5G, Opensignal noted in the report.

“While smaller markets top the rankings for 5G download speed, the position of Saudi Arabia is notable: its users saw a strong uplift in both speed and video experience, as well as good 5G availability despite its size,” the report adds.

The UAE tops for 5G games experience with a score of 74 on a 100-point scale.

While UAE is top for 5G Download Speed its score slips behind Kuwait on 5G Video Experience with a score of 72.4 on a 100-point scale.

In 5G Voice App Experience, Qatar tops the rankings with a score of 80.6 on a 100-point scale. This measures the experience for over-the-top voice services using popular mobile voice apps including WhatsApp, Skype, Facebook Messenger and Facetime.

In 2021, UAE had the fastest network speed of 959.39 Mbps which placed it at the top of the global list.

In May 2019, Etisalat – the UAE’s biggest telecoms operator – became the first service provider in the region to announce the availability of a 5G network, supporting smartphones for commercial use. It was soon followed by the UAE’s second-biggest operator du, Saudi Telecom Company and Bahrain’s Batelco.

The Gulf region will have 62 million 5G mobile subscribers by 2026 and they will account for nearly 73 per cent of all mobile subscriptions in the region, according to a report by Swedish company Ericsson.
